    Why were these pale, blind fish in the lower Congo River dying...of the bends? Fascinating research presented at by of ; an investigation into fish evolution led to the discovery that the Congo is the deepest river on Earth.

  19. Scientists recently installed the world’s highest weather stations atop Mt. Everest. At , an incredible early result was revealed: Everest’s peak experiences levels of sunshine we’d expect to see ~in space~. Me for ⁦⁩:
